Looking at the current standings, we're seeing some fascinating developments that could shape the entire postseason landscape. The Denver Nuggets have been absolutely dominant, playing with that championship swagger we saw last year. Nikola Jokić continues to be a walking triple-double threat, averaging around 28 points, 14 rebounds, and 9 assists through the first two rounds. Then you've got the Minnesota Timberwolves, who've been the surprise package of these playoffs with their suffocating defense. Anthony Edwards has taken that superstar leap we've all been waiting for, putting up nearly 32 points per game while playing elite perimeter defense. The Dallas Mavericks have been another fascinating story, with Luka Dončić and Kyrie Irving forming one of the most dynamic backcourts I've witnessed in recent memory. Their offensive rating of 118.7 in these playoffs is simply staggering. Meanwhile, the Oklahoma City Thunder have defied all expectations with their young core, showing maturity beyond their years. Shai Gilgeous-Alexander has been nothing short of spectacular, averaging 30.2 points while maintaining incredible efficiency from the field. The battle in the paint has been particularly telling. Teams are averaging about 42.3 rebounds per game, with offensive boards becoming increasingly crucial in tight contests. Second-chance points have decided several close games already, and I expect this trend to continue as we move deeper into the playoffs. The team that controls the glass often controls the game, and we're seeing that play out dramatically in these conference semifinals.
